1. Overland Configuration for Adventures
Set up your Tacoma with an overland configuration to carry equipment for outdoor activities like camping. My overland configuration has transformed impromptu weekend trips.
2. Foldable Storage Solutions
Choose foldable storage solutions that can be stowed away when not being used. These have been excellent for those occasions when I need temporary additional space.
3. Cargo Arrangement Systems
Spend money on cargo arrangement systems that use dividers to secure your load effectively. These systems have revolutionized how I carry different cargo, preventing any unwelcome movements.
4. Rooftop Storage Boxes
Improve your storage capacity using rooftop storage boxes for bigger, larger items. These boxes have helped me carry everything from camping equipment to holiday decorations.
5. Secure Using Bed Covers
Safeguard your belongings using a reliable bed cover that secures everything against weather and theft. What I appreciate most is how a bed cover introduces an added layer of protection while maintaining an elegant appearance.
6. Velcro Straps for Secure Storage
Use velcro straps to secure loose items and prevent shifting during drives. This simple hack has kept my Tacoma tidy and secure.
7. Personalized Drawer Builds
Feeling artistic? Try making your own personalized drawer builds for a custom fit. I once built a set from recycled wood, introducing a personal touch to my truck’s storage.
8. Toolboxes for Convenient Storage
Durable toolboxes attached to the bed offer a tough choice for keeping all your tools in one area. They’re essential in my Tacoma for straightforward accessibility and arrangement.
